Hi all — the Nightloom scheduler now owns all nightly data backfills for the Corvida warehouse. Jobs are declared in the backfills repo; the scheduler picks them up at 01:00 local and retries twice with backoff. If a backfill fails three nights running, it's auto-paused and the owning team is paged. Manual reruns go through the scheduler UI, not cron. Tonight's run was produced by the build shown below.

trace token, bawef-hagug: htk14_86959b54a07f99

Subject: Welcome to the cron migration

Hi, and welcome aboard! You're joining mid-flight: we're moving the old Tallow cron jobs over to the Driftplan workflow engine, one batch at a time. About a third are migrated, so on-call means watching both systems for now. If a job fires twice, that's the dual-run safety net — annoying but expected. The migration tracker and per-job status notes are on the internal page below.

runbook for badug-kadup: https://confluence.zemvarlabs.internal/projects/browse/display/projects/bd1b

Subject: Quickstore 4.2 — bloom filter now fronts the KV layer

Plugin authors: starting with this release, Quickstore places a bloom filter ahead of the key-value store. Negative lookups return faster; false positives fall through safely. No API changes are required on your side. Verify your plugin against the staging build referenced below.

session token of fahif-tadup = htk3_9c7

Verify that the Cartwheel checkout flow has been load tested within the past quarter at 3x projected peak traffic, including the payment-authorization step and inventory-hold service. Confirm that p99 latency stayed under the 1.2s budget, that error rates remained below 0.1%, and that the test report is archived in the compliance folder with graphs attached. Results are not valid without a recorded run date and the reviewer's initials. Discrepancies should be raised directly with the accountable engineer named below.

approver of yawig-yajef = Briius Jorix

FINANCE REVIEW SUMMARY — Heads of Department

Q3 analysis shows that Tarnwell Fabrications now accounts for 41% of recurring revenue, up from 28% last year. This concentration exceeds our internal risk threshold and leaves margins exposed to a single renewal cycle. Mitigation options were assessed, and the preferred path is set out below.

management briefing: Project Ulavan slips by two quarters because of the staffing delay.